Pricing

Legacy Village at Plantation Manor offers competitive pricing for its residents, particularly when compared to the surrounding county and state averages. For instance, the semi-private rooms are available at $2,500 per month, which is significantly lower than both Thomas County's average of $3,283 and Georgia's state average of $2,529. Similarly, the studio apartments are priced at $3,200, providing an attractive option in contrast to the higher costs in Thomas County at $3,765 and the state average of $3,520. However, for those considering two-bedroom accommodations, Legacy Village stands at $4,000 per month - slightly above the county's average of $4,135 but more affordable than Georgia's state mean of $3,921. Overall, Legacy Village positions itself as a value-driven choice for prospective residents seeking quality care without compromising their budget.

    Review

    Legacy Village at Plantation Manor has elicited a range of opinions from visitors and residents regarding its services, staff, and overall environment. One persistent theme across multiple reviews is the dedication and kindness displayed by the staff. Many reviewers highlight that the staff members are not only helpful to the residents but also extend their kindness to guests. This level of care has made some visitors feel comfortable recommending Legacy Village for their loved ones, citing it as a place where individuals can receive quality assistance in what can be an emotionally challenging transition.

    Contrastingly, other reviewers have expressed serious concerns about communication within the facility, particularly between administration and families. A poignant example involved a reviewer whose father had recently passed away; they reported a distressing experience when the administration filed a lawsuit against them for payment before even sending out a bill. Such experiences foster distrust among families already navigating difficult emotional landscapes while caring for aging loved ones. This lack of transparent communication was echoed in other reviews, highlighting how crucial it is for families to feel that they are informed and listened to during their time at Legacy Village.

    The food provided at Legacy Village has emerged as one of the most contentious points among reviewers. While some acknowledged that meals might suit older adults' preferences for comfort food, many felt that the quality was subpar compared to other facilities or even prison standards in some extreme cases. Concerns were raised about meals being frozen or canned, leading to an overall consensus that the dining experience could use significant improvement, aligning both taste and nutritional value with modern standards of assisted living cuisine.

    Despite its shortcomings related to food and administrative challenges, many reviews noted that there were engaging activities on offer at Legacy Village, such as bingo and exercise classes. The community atmosphere fosters daily engagement opportunities for residents while contributing positively to their well-being. Furthermore, positive feedback regarding specific staff members like Kim and Deidre surfaced in several comments; they were commended for being easy to work with and genuinely invested in each resident’s care plan.

    Unfortunately, staffing issues appeared repeatedly throughout various accounts. Several reviewers indicated that although dedicated staff worked hard under strenuous conditions—often receiving minimal pay—the facility seemed inadequately staffed. This shortage created inconsistencies in care delivery and attention towards residents’ needs. Complaints also surfaced about nursing oversight; although claims stated that two nurses were always present, reports suggested these individuals often fulfilled administrative roles rather than actively attending to sick residents.

    Ultimately, legacy Village at Plantation Manor stands at a crossroads between commendable service from individual staff members and systemic deficiencies in management practices. Some reviewers observed improvements due to recent changes in administration within Plantation Manor with ongoing renovations aimed at enhancing both facilities and services offered therein—a positive sign indicating potential growth moving forward. For those searching for senior care options along the Tallahassee-Valdosta corridor, opinions suggest it remains one of the better facilities available today despite facing some hurdles characterized by uninspired dining options and staffing challenges requiring continuous attention from corporate oversight.

    • sundown syndromeComprehending Evening Confusion in Dementia: Causes, Manifestations, and Support

      Sundown syndrome, or sundowning, is a phenomenon in dementia patients characterized by increased confusion and agitation during late afternoon and evening, influenced by factors like disrupted circadian rhythms and fatigue. Effective caregiver strategies include establishing routines and managing environmental light while addressing caregiver stress through support services.

    • delirium vs dementiaDelirium and Dementia: Unraveling the Key Differences

      Delirium is a rapidly onset, reversible cognitive disturbance often caused by acute medical issues, while dementia is a gradual and irreversible decline due to chronic neurodegenerative diseases. Accurate differentiation between the two is essential for appropriate treatment and management in older adults.
